Web4 apr. 2024 · 2-syllable words with 2 closed syllables: starfish (star – fish), napkin (nap – kin), picnic (pic-nic). When a vowel is closed in by a consonant, it makes its short sound. When we are teaching our children to read, we can explain to them that the consonant is actually keeping that vowel sound closed and short.
